#e296ce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e296ce is composed of 88.6% red, 58.8%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.6% magenta, 8.8%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 315.8 degrees, a saturation of 56.7% and a lightness of 73.7%. #e296ce color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c52d9d.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#e296ce
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030102 is the darkest color, while #fbf2f9 is the lightest one.
